‘A Walking Miracle’: Little Rock Student Recovering After Near-Fatal Brain Injury


(THV11) – A Little Rock native and former college baseball player is thriving two years after a brain injury that doctors thought he might not survive. “I absolutely remember nothing,” said 21-year-old Luke McKnight of the incident. “I remember nothing.”

For McKnight, putting together the pieces of what happened that weekend in early 2023 has been impossible. He’s been told that he was spending the weekend in Fayetteville with friends during a rare weekend off from his own season at Southern Arkansas Tech. His mom, Catherine McKnight, can fill in the gaps from there.

“I got a call from the police saying, ‘Is your son Luke McKnight?’ Catherine remembered. “And I said, ‘It is.’ And they said ‘He’s been in an accident in Fayetteville.” It was a car accident that left Luke with severe brain damage and, according to doctors, a 20% chance of survival and a 5% chance of regaining functionality.
